GODIN, David (Dave) Wilfred – Dave Godin, 63, passed away peacefully on May 11, 2018 at his home in London, Ontario surrounded by his loved ones. Dave will be lovingly remembered by his wife Susan and his children Chris and Victoria. He was the son of the late Wilfred (2012) and Georgette (2007) Godin. He will be missed by his sisters Michelle (Bob) Mitchell, Bonnie (Fraser) Cartwright, and his brother Len (Nancy). Dave will also be fondly remembered by his in-laws Paul and Eva Goud, Andrew (Cathy) Goud, Jeff (Pat) Goud, Linda (Derek) Longman and Stewart (Margaret) Goud and his numerous nephews and nieces.
Dave proudly served in the Armed Forces for 27 years before retiring in London in August 2000. After a brief break, Dave joined the team at McCabe Promotional Advertising Inc., leaving in 2014 after being diagnosed with ALS.
We will all miss Dave’s quick wit and sense of humour. He loved saying and doing the unexpected and making people laugh.
Visitation on Wednesday from 7-9 pm at Harris Funeral Home, 220 St. James St. at Richmond. A memorial service will be held at Bellamere Winery, 1260 Gainsborough Road, Hyde Park on Thursday, May 17 at 1 pm with a Celebration of Life reception to follow.
